Bathing

Each bathroom features high-quality marble, generous space, steady hot water and robust water pressure. Suites include heated floors. Toiletries are the property’s own, practical rather than extravagant.

Sleep experience

Expect supportive mattresses and fine sheets; pillow options are available if you ask. City-facing rooms tend to be peaceful all night, while the standard courtyard rooms might get a bit of the lobby’s background buzz in the late hours – request a skyline view if you’re an early sleeper.

Outlook & quiet

The skyline rooms are what make 41stkxshift stand out. The cost-saving courtyard rooms come with simpler outlooks. Higher floors are generally most silent; at night, a little noise from below can carry upwards through the atrium.

Accessibility

Step-free options, accessible showers, and lift access are handled well. You’ll find accessible accommodation not only in entry-level rooms but across a range of categories.

Best pick

Recommended

Staying one night? The City Deluxe has you covered. If you’re staying for a couple nights, the Panorama Suite gives extra space and wonderful views. Grand Terrace Suite is worth it only when you truly want luxury, like the terrace or a private butler.
